Job DescriptionLed by the community's Health and Wellness Director (RN), our Wellness Nurse is a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) who provides direct nursing care to the residents with an emphasis on holistic wellness. They also help supervise the day-to-day nursing activities performed by care staff of Certified Nursing Assistants.
